President of the International fellowship for Christian churches Bishop Simon Chihana has died.

The man of God died in the early hours of Monday.

In 2019 Bishop Chihana had gone on a 60 day prayer and fasting to pray for the nation of Zambia among others on account that so many things have gone wrong in the nation of Zambia and beyond.

The late Bishop was also a defender of human rights and heavily campaigned against the now forgotten bill ten which he then described as an evil document.

Bishop Chihana was also a serious critic of the government in the area of corruption and oppression of citizens.

Recently the late man of God predicted that the 2021 general elections will only be between president Edgar Lungu of the Patriotic Front (PF) and Hakainde Hichilema of the opposition United Party for National Development UPND urging the winner to serious relook into the free falling economy.

In his own assessment, Bishop Chihana said the prices of food and non food items had gone beyond the reach of ordinary citizens.
